Hi guys, can someone help me? my marconi 2955 has this problem:

The RF signal generator doesn't have frequency stability, I've put a external GPSDO on 1MHz input, but doesn't change anything, when you measure the frequency with a frequency counter, you cannot see any problems, but, when use a HF radio in SSB mode it's so clear the instability, I tested the HF radio with other RF signal generator and there's no problem at all.

Does anyone already had this problem?
Or a suggestion to solve it?

Please keep in mind that the Marconi 2955, is it a 2955 or a 2955A, was never designed for use with SSB communications links, it’s primary role is for use with private FM radio links.

It sounds that you are hearing phase noise from the Rx side signal generator, but from your description I cannot be certain.  Without access to measurements from a modulation meter such as a Marconi 2305 or a HP8901/A/B it is impossible to say if the 2955/A meets its specifications or not.

It is normal that if you listen to the 2955’s signal generator with a modern HF radio or HF transceiver you will hear all sorts of burbling noises.
